Wash Project Officer

DISCLAIMER It is mandatory to mention the job title in the subjet of your application email Applicants who do not mention the position they are applying for will be disregarded   GENERAL POSITION SUMMARY: The WASH Project Officer will advance Mercy Corps’ ongoing programming in Beqaa Region, Lebanon by being responsible for the day to day project implementation that focuses on increasing access to safe water, sanitation services/facilities, and proper Hygiene conditions and practices to Syrian refugees and host communities, including local government engagement, scale up & sustainability,  promotion of Syrian and Lebanese participation in project activities, strengthening the role of women in decision making, participation in coordination activities meetings and liaising with relevant government departments in the field. In addition, the project officer will be greatly involved in and responsible for producing key documents and materials, providing support to plan and implement key communications components of ongoing programming focused on WASH. The project officer will be the focal point for liaison with, and follow up and capacity building of local partners.     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S: Oversee day to day project implementation and ensure effective and timely completion of WASH interventions; Support in carrying out community mobilization and hygiene promotion sessions among the refugees and host communities; Conduct WASH assessments to determine scope of work, resource requirement and estimated cost; Provide support including on-the-job training, supervision and monitoring of volunteers and local partner staff; Monitor the WASH project process as per Mercy Corps regulations and standards; Prepare weekly field reports to be submitted to WASH Project Manager; Support and coordinate agency and donor monitoring visits; Jointly with WASH team, conduct emergency assessments and, in coordination with others, design and organize the implementation of appropriate responses; Support in establishing and maintaining proper project documentation and records, including but not limited to: needs assessments questionnaires, monitoring questionnaires, certificates of vouchers receipts, consolidated list of beneficiaries, photos etc.; Prepare and follow up in support the Project Manager in conducting monthly house-to-house visits to carry out profiling of targeted households, verify the eligibility of households selected for minor repair purposes, identify non-food item needs, and execute needs assessments and monitoring questionnaires as needed; Maintain and update village level database of refugee profiles and sector-based needs; Conduct himself/herself both professionally and personally in such a manner as to bring credit to Mercy Corps and to not jeopardize its humanitarian mission; Develop key productions to increase Mercy Corps’ communication within local communities in Lebanon to promote program activities and increase awareness and acceptance; Assist the Media & Communications Coordinator in producing communication material and publications that market Mercy Corps' work (online, offline and audiovisual) in coordination with the Program Teams for key donors, peer agencies, and other key stakeholders; Assist the Media & Communications Coordinator in organizing events such as receptions, conferences, TV and radio talk shows and press releases; Review and apply existing water quality testing, water trucking and de-sludging services and advise on how to improve further, including development of new materials to increase community awareness as well as visibility; Coordinate with M&E team to gather and use existing success stories that highlight Mercy Corps’ interventions for donors; Other duties as assigned by the supervisor.   Other Ensure all activities are gender sensitive and follow Mercy Corps’ Gender Equity Policy; Apply Do No Harm standards to ensure activities do not have detrimental affects on vulnerable communities; Contribute to monthly reports and other ad hoc reports to meet donor and internal requirements; Participate in internal office coordination and planning meetings and workshops; Conduct himself/herself both professionally and personally in such a manner as to bring credit toMercy Corpsand to not jeopardize its humanitarian mission; Other assigned tasks, as necessary.   S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ITY: None REPORTS DIRECTLY TO:  WASH Project Manager WORKS DIRECTLY WITH: WASH Sector Team, M&E Team, and Operations Team and Local partners   KNOWLEDGE AND EXPERIENCE: Minimum of 4 years’ work experience working directly for an NGO or relevant organization in Bekaa region Bachelor’s Degree in Public Health, Social science, Environmental Sciences or any relevant field required Familiarity with the issues of urban and village water systems water quality, sanitation and solid waste management. Demonstrate good expertise in emergency response implementation especially in the refugee (ISs) context in Bekaa. Commitment to local capacity building and the ability to engage local stakeholders in project design and implementation Demonstrated capacity to collaborate closely with INGOs and national NGOs and CBOs Good organizational and basic project management skills Experience working with refugees or other vulnerable population required, implementing a WASH project and conducting training is preferred Proven understanding of Do No Harm principles and methodology with applied experience implementing projects with/for women and girls The applicants should have good written and verbal English and Arabic skills Must be computer-literate, particularly in programs such as MS Word and MS Excel.  Strong organizational and collaboration skills required, with the ability to work independently and be self-directed, as necessary Must work well as a member of a team, with willingness to travel throughout Lebanon, sometimes staying overnight, as the job requires   SUCCESS FACTORS: The successful project officer will be bright, energetic, hard-working and eager to learn.  S/he will take a deep personal interest in humanitarian and development assistance.  S/he will be attentive to detail and able to carry out assigned tasks in a timely manner and according to a very high standard of quality.  S/he will be creative and flexible, but at the same time will not have any difficulty in adhering to systems and procedures.  S/he will strictly follow all protocols related to safety and security.
